Power Law Model

Test data from a rheometer of several test fluids are considered to be described by the power law relationship:

\tau=k\dot{\gamma}^{n}           (9.11)

If the consistency parameter k for all the fluids is 0.01 (Nsm^{–2})^n , illustrate the variation of shear stress with shear rate for values of n of 0.9, 1, and 1.1 up to shear rates of 100 s^{–1} .

The calculation of the shear stress is given in Figure 9.8. With the straight line that corresponds to a Newtonian fluid (n = 1), the curve above (n > 1) corresponds to a dilatant while the curve below corresponds to a pseudoplastic (n < 1).
